Output e84c65e3bb99e04cafa0b839bb05c7a9dbfa4440830e4c6e826ed0a54d2685b4:2

value
595940
script pubkey
OP_0 OP_PUSHBYTES_20 997d1d8e67fcb3bd7853f0c3ac2c4bc36eeed37d
address
bc1qn973mrn8ljem67zn7rp6ctztcdhwa5maczwgdy
transaction
e84c65e3bb99e04cafa0b839bb05c7a9dbfa4440830e4c6e826ed0a54d2685b4
spent
true